    • N
      vz: factor out config update flags checks · 3fbb7dba
      Nikolay Shirokovskiy 提交于
      Actually this is not pure refactoring. Part of common code is
      replaced with virDomainObjUpdateModificationImpact and this
      a good replacement. It includes removed check of inactive
      domain and active flags set. Additionally we resolve
      current flag in accordance with current state of domain.
      Thus it becames possible to attach/detach devices for
      inactive domains if this flag is set.

    • E
      po: fix POTFILES.in file ordering · e72667bd
      Erik Skultety 提交于
      When it comes to a situation that a new translatable file needs to be added
      into the list of files, an automatically generated patch is proposed during
      syntax-check. However, the diff was made against a sorted list of files and
      the same sorted list of files + the new file that actually needs to be added
      into the list. Since we do not keep POTFILES sorted, the proposed patch thus
      can't be applied...most of the time - depending on the context.

    • R
      qemu: fix build without gnutls installed · acb63aaf
      Roman Bogorodskiy 提交于
      Move including of gnutls/gnutls.h in qemu/qemu_domain.c under the
      "ifdef WITH_GNUTLS" check because otherwise it fails like this:
      
        CC       qemu/libvirt_driver_qemu_impl_la-qemu_domain.lo
      qemu/qemu_domain.c:50:10: fatal error: 'gnutls/gnutls.h' file not found
      
      in case if gnutls is not installed on the system.

    • A
      qemu: Explicitly check for gnutls_rnd() · 2d23d145
      Andrea Bolognani 提交于
      Our use of gnutls_rnd(), introduced with commit ad7520e8, is
      conditional to the availability of the <gnutls/crypto.h> header
      file.
      
      Such check, however, turns out not to be strict enough, as there
      are some versions of GnuTLS (eg. 2.8.5 from CentOS 6) that provide
      the header file, but not the function itself, which was introduced
      only in GnuTLS 2.12.0.
      
      Introduce an explicit check for the function.

    • A
      host-validate: Improve CPU flags processing · c661b675
      Andrea Bolognani 提交于
      Instead of relying on substring search, tokenize the input
      and process each CPU flag separately. This ensures CPU flag
      detection will continue to work correctly even if we start
      looking for CPU flags whose name might appear as part of
      other CPU flags' names.
      
      The result of processing is stored in a virBitmap, which
      means we don't have to parse /proc/cpuinfo in its entirety
      for each single CPU flag we want to check.
      
      Moreover, use of the newly-introduced virHostValidateCPUFlag
      enumeration ensures we don't go looking for random CPU flags
      which might actually be simple typos.

    • N
      vz: support boot order in domain xml dump · 032c5bf9
      Nikolay Shirokovskiy 提交于
      As usual we try to deal correctly with vz domains that were
      created by other means and thus can have all range of SDK domain
      parameters. If vz domain boot order can't be represented
      in libvirt os boot section let's give warning and make os boot section
      represent SDK to some extent.
      
      1. Os boot section supports up to 4 boot devices. Here we just
      cut SDK boot order up to this limit. Not too bad.
      
      2. If there is a floppy in boot order let's just skip it.
      Anyway we don't show it in the xml. Not too bad too.
      
      3. SDK boot order with unsupported disks order. Say we have "hdb, hda" in
      SDK. We can not present this thru os boot order. Well let's just
      give warning but leave double <boot dev='hd'/> in xml. It's
      kind of misleading but we warn you!
      
      SDK boot order have an extra parameters 'inUse' and 'sequenceIndex'
      which makes our task more complicated. In realitly however 'inUse'
      is always on and 'sequenceIndex' is not less than 'boot position index'
      which simplifies out task back again! To be on a safe side let's explicitly
      check for this conditions!
      
      We have another exercise here. We want to check for unrepresentable
      condition 3 (see above). The tricky part is that in contrast to
      domains defined thru this driver 3-rd party defined domains can
      have device ordering different from default. Thus we need
      some id to check that N-th boot disk of os boot section is same as
      N-th boot disk of SDK boot. This is what prlsdkBootOrderCheck
      for. It uses disks sources paths as id for disks and iface names
      for network devices.

    • N
      vz: support boot order specification on define domain · 497dcafc
      Nikolay Shirokovskiy 提交于
      The patch makes some refactoring of the existing code. Current boot order spec code
      makes very simple thing in somewhat obscure way. In case of VMs
      it sets the first hdd as the only bootable device. In case of CTs it
      doesn't touch the boot order at all if one of the filesystems is mounted to root.
      Otherwise like in case of VMs it sets the first hdd as the only bootable
      device and additionally sets this device mount point to root. Refactored
      code makes all this explicit.
      
      The actual boot order support is simple. Common libvirt domain xml parsing
      code makes the exact ordering of disks devices as described in docs
      for boot ordering (disks are sorted by bus order first, device target
      second. Bus order is the order of disk buses appearence in original
      xml. Device targets order is alphabetical). We add devices in the
      same order and SDK designates device indexes sequentially for each
      device type. Thus device index is equal to its boot index. For
      example N-th cdrom in boot specification refers to sdk cdrom with
      it's device index N.
      
      If there is no boot spec in xml the parsing code will add <boot dev='hdd'>
      for HVMs automatically and we backward compatibly set fist hdd as
      bootable.

    • P
      qemu: perf: Fix crash/memory corruption on failed VM start · 03e8d5fb
      Peter Krempa 提交于
      The new perf code didn't bother to clear a pointer in 'priv' causing a
      double free or other memory corruption goodness if a VM failed to start.
      
      Clear the pointer after freeing the memory.
